控件处理方法、装置、电子设备及介质制造方法及图纸

技术编号:36078200 阅读:24 留言:0更新日期:2022-12-24 10:50
本发明专利技术公开了一种控件处理方法、装置、电子设备及介质,涉及计算机技术领域。该方法包括:显示控件联动配置页面,所述控件联动配置页面用于配置待联动控件和所述待联动控件对应的联动配置项;响应于针对所述待联动控件对应的联动配置项的配置操作,接收所述待联动控件的联动配置信息;所述联动配置信息用于确定针对所述待联动控件的联动事件,所述联动事件包括联动条件和联动动作;显示所述待联动控件执行所述联动动作后的联动结果,其中,所述联动动作是在满足所述联动条件的情况下执行的。该方法能够通过配置化的方式,实现了控件的条件化动态联动,降低了人力成本和时间成本,提高了用户体验。高了用户体验。高了用户体验。

【技术实现步骤摘要】
控件处理方法、装置、电子设备及介质


[0001]本专利技术涉及计算机
,尤其涉及一种控件处理方法、装置、电子设备及介质。

技术介绍

[0002]现有产品控件的配置都是固定的,若要修改控件,例如对控件进行联动处理,则需要在控件相关的代码中进行修改,因此需要用户从较多的代码中找到控件对应的代码,然后进行修改。这种修改方式不够灵活,无法动态化配置,效率低下,且容易出错,在复杂场景下无法直接通过配置实现修改。

技术实现思路

[0003]为解决上述技术问题或至少部分地解决上述技术问题,本专利技术实施例提供一种控件处理方法、装置、电子设备及介质。
[0004]第一方面,本专利技术实施例提供了一种控件处理方法,应用于客户端,所述方法包括:显示控件联动配置页面,所述控件联动配置页面用于配置待联动控件和所述待联动控件对应的联动配置项;响应于针对所述待联动控件对应的联动配置项的配置操作,接收所述待联动控件的联动配置信息;所述联动配置信息用于确定针对所述待联动控件的联动事件,所述联动事件包括联动条件和联动动作;显示所述待联动控件执行所述本文档来自技高网...

【技术保护点】

【技术特征摘要】
1.一种控件处理方法,其特征在于,应用于客户端,所述方法包括:显示控件联动配置页面,所述控件联动配置页面用于配置待联动控件和所述待联动控件对应的联动配置项;响应于针对所述待联动控件对应的联动配置项的配置操作,接收所述待联动控件的联动配置信息;所述联动配置信息用于确定针对所述待联动控件的联动事件,所述联动事件包括联动条件和联动动作;显示所述待联动控件执行所述联动动作后的联动结果,其中,所述联动动作是在满足所述联动条件的情况下执行的。2.根据权利要求1所述的方法,其特征在于,所述控件联动配置页面包括第一控件;所述待联动控件包括联动触发控件;所述响应于针对所述待联动控件对应的联动配置项的配置操作,接收所述待联动控件的联动配置信息,包括:响应于针对所述第一控件的触发操作,显示联动条件配置页面;所述联动条件配置页面用于显示至少一个可选控件;响应于针对所述至少一个可选控件的选择操作,确定选中控件,将所述选中控件作为所述联动触发控件;显示所述联动触发控件对应的条件配置项,所述联动触发控件对应的条件配置项根据所述联动触发控件的类型确定;响应于针对所述条件配置项的配置操作,接收针对所述联动触发控件的联动条件配置信息,所述联动条件配置信息用于确定针对所述联动触发控件的联动条件。3.根据权利要求2所述的方法,其特征在于,所述条件配置项包括以下一种或多种:触发源配置项、函数配置项、运算符配置项、条件判断符配置项、条件值配置项;所述响应于针对所述条件配置项的配置操作,接收针对所述联动触发控件的联动条件配置信息,包括:响应于针对所述触发源配置项的配置操作,接收针对所述联动触发控件的触发源配置信息;响应于针对所述函数配置项或所述运算符配置项的配置操作,接收针对所述联动触发控件的运算表达式配置信息;响应于针对所述条件判断符配置项和所述条件值配置项的配置操作,接收针对所述联动触发控件的判断条件配置信息;所述触发源配置信息、所述运算表达式配置信息和所述判断条件配置信息用于确定针对所述联动触发控件的联动条件配置信息。4.根据权利要求3所述的方法,其特征在于,在所述触发源配置项被配置为表格列值的情况下,所述条件配置项还包括列项配置项,该列项配置项用于从多个可选列中选择目标列。5.根据权利要求2所述的方法,其特征在于,所述控件联动配置页面包括第二控件;所述待联动控件包括联动受控控件;所述响应于针对所述待联动控件对应的联动配置项的配置操作,接收所述待联动控件的联动配置信息,包括:响应于针对所述第二控件的触发操作,显示联动动作配置页面;所述联动动作配置页面用于显示至少一个可选控件;
响应于针对所述至少一个可选控件的选择操作,确定选中控件,将所述选中控件作为所述联动受控控件;显示所述联动触发控件对应的动作配置项;所述联动受控控件对应的动作配置项根据所述联动受控控件的类型确定;响应于针对所述动作配置项的配置操作,接收针对所述联动受控控件的联动动作配置信息,所述联动配置信息用于确定针对所述联动受控控件的联动动作。6.根据权利要求5所述的方法,其特征在于,所述动作配置项包括以下一种或多种:字段变更配置项、值变更配置项和控件属性变更配置项。7.根据权利要求6所述的方法,其特征在于,所述控件属性变更配置项用于配置所述联动受控控件的控件属性,所述控件属性包括以下一种或多种:隐藏、显示、必填、非必须、默认值和显示格式。8.根据权利要求2或5所述的方法,其特征在于,所述联动触发控件的类型或所述联动受控控件的类型包括以下一种或多种:文本、文本框、文本域、数字框、日期框、单选框、复选框、下拉框、链接按钮、数据表格和可变行表格。9.一种控件处理方法,其特征在于,应用于服务端,所述方法包括:响应于控件选择操作,确定待联动控件;获取针对所述待联动控件的联动配置信息,根据所述联动配置信息确定针对所述...

【专利技术属性】
技术研发人员:马敏姚秋实
申请(专利权)人:中电金信软件有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1